Ingredients:

  • 1 bone-in prime rib roast (6–8 pounds)
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• Garlic cloves (optional, for added flavor)

Instructions:

  • Prep the Roast:
    Take the prime rib out of the fridge 1 hour before cooking to let it come to room temperature. Preheat your oven to 500°F (260°C).
  • Season Generously:
    Place the roast on a rack in a roasting pan. Rub the entire roast with olive oil, then season liberally with salt and pepper. For extra flavor, make small slits with a paring knife and insert garlic cloves throughout the roast.
  • Initial High-Heat Roast:
    Roast at 500°F for 15 minutes to create a flavorful crust.
  • Lower the Heat and Finish:
    Reduce the oven to 325°F (160°C). Continue roasting until it reaches your preferred doneness:
    • Medium-rare: 135°F (57°C)
    • Medium: 140°F (60°C)
    • Well-done: 150°F (66°C)
      Use a meat thermometer for accuracy!
  • Rest the Roast:
    Remove from oven and tent with foil. Let rest for 15–20 minutes so the juices redistribute before slicing.
  • Serve:
    Slice and serve warm with your favorite sides—like roasted veggies, mashed potatoes, or horseradish sauce!
